Klorox wrote:
to start with, at lvl2, you don't yet have access to 2nd lvl spells... period.
Otherwise, you don't have to make a caster lvl roll to scribe a scroll of a spell you can normally cast, and you can't scribe a spell you can't cast yet, period.
You have no slots to cast 2nd level spells at Wizard 2.
You can learn and enter into your spellbook 2nd or higher spells if you make the spellcraft check.You can scribe spells you cannot cast. Most common would be scribing a spell for the cleric who does not have Scribe Scroll. Again, governed by the spellcraft check.
You can scribe a spell you cannot cast yet. Same thing, just need someone else who can supply the spell.
As scrolls do not have a CL prerequisite, not having the CL doesn't matter.
